Transaction 4f8000dc8ee8fe4a17040fb17daabc4ab1121a106d44935176bbeb18f0b3554e

1 Input
2 Outputs
  • 4f8000dc8ee8fe4a17040fb17daabc4ab1121a106d44935176bbeb18f0b3554e:0
  • value  920300
    address  1CEURLeYRtstm5fjrhucBXt9YnTRC3NNRq
  • 4f8000dc8ee8fe4a17040fb17daabc4ab1121a106d44935176bbeb18f0b3554e:1
  • value  19835316
    address  1PbJ2KeJQyehgTBPjKwnLGYXYBwWnFGePy